Settlements


In a mesothelioma lawsuit, attorneys negotiate on behalf of the victims and their families with defendants (manufacturers of asbestos-based products). Plaintiffs may receive compensation for medical expenses, lost wages and suffering and pain. Compensation amounts are also based on financial difficulties, such as a drop in household income due to caregiving or the necessity to focus solely on mesothelioma treatment.

State courts accept lawsuits and have the statute of limitations. These rules differ based on the jurisdiction and can affect the time frame that victims or their families are allowed to file a lawsuit. Mesothelioma lawyers may review the laws of the state to determine the length of time a victim has to seek compensation.

The majority of mesothelioma cases are settled through negotiations, and a lawsuit only goes to trial in the event that a settlement cannot be reached. Statute of Limitations

Patients who have been diagnosed with mesothelioma, or any other asbestos-related illness, have a limited amount of time to bring a lawsuit against the negligent companies that exposed them. Mesothelioma compensation can help the victims and their families cope with financial burdens that arise from expensive treatment as well as lost wages and other expenses. It is essential to file your mesothelioma suit within the timeframe of the statute of limitations otherwise, you may lose the right to bring a suit.

Statutes of limitations are legal deadlines that limit the amount of time a victim can make a claim for asbestos-related injuries. The statutes of limitation vary according to the state and the nature of the case. Some have shorter deadlines than others. The time limit is determined by the medical health of the patient and when the patient knew about asbestos exposure.

In most personal injury cases, such as the statute of limitations clock begins to tick when an injury or accident occurs. top mesothelioma lawyer is an uncommon disease because of its long duration of latency. These diseases can take decades to show symptoms after exposure. So, a mesothelioma time of limitations clock usually starts at the time of diagnosis, not the date of exposure.

Furthermore, the statute of limitations could start differently based on the condition of the patient or deceased. If a mesothelioma sufferer has passed away, their spouse or other family members can bring a wrongful death lawsuit to recover lost income and funeral costs. Wrongful Death claims are usually subject to an additional statute of limitations than personal injuries and each state has its own regulations regarding who can bring them.

To be able to claim compensation for damages lawsuits against asbestos-causing producers and trust funds are required to be filed within the statutes of limitations. Statutes of limitations are designed to safeguard plaintiffs and their families from being forced to accept less than they deserve. In a mesothelioma suit the speed of action is crucial since evidence may vanish over time or be disputed. To ensure that you don't miss the statutes of limitations, victims are advised to seek legal counsel as quickly as possible following their diagnosis.

Attorney Fees

If you're mesothelioma sufferer, you may be concerned about the amount an attorney will charge. This is totally normal. You might already be struggling with escalating medical bills and a loss of income as you seek treatment or care for a family member diagnosed with mesothelioma.

However, a mesothelioma attorney should not add to your financial burden. The vast majority of attorneys operate on a contingency fee which means that you will not pay your attorney until you receive compensation from your asbestos case. This is an excellent way to aid mesothelioma sufferers and their families who are unable to afford legal fees up front.

Additionally, many mesothelioma lawyers will cover any necessary investigatory expenses needed to pursue a mesothelioma case. Asbestos litigation is often complicated and requires a lot of investigation. It could also involve locating coworkers with information about asbestos exposure.

Your mesothelioma lawyer can review your employment history and assist you in identifying asbestos-related exposures. They can use photographs of old asbestos products and packaging, access employment records, and locate relatives and friends who worked with you during the when you were exposed to asbestos.

Mesothelioma victims are often awarded damages for medical costs, lost wages, pain and suffering and other losses. A mesothelioma lawyer can assist you estimate the potential award amounts, and discuss with you the best options to pursue them.

Asbestos-related victims may be eligible for compensation through mesothelioma agreement, trial verdicts, and asbestos trust funds. A law firm that has a an established track record of success fighting for asbestos victims will ensure you receive the maximum amount of compensation.

Additionally veterans who were in the military and who developed mesothelioma are able to submit an VA benefits claim and a mesothelioma lawsuit. There are certain rules that a mesothelioma lawyer will explain to you.
